About the Role
As a Cloud Engineer (Frontend-Leaning), you will focus on building and maintaining dashboards and admin consoles while supporting the cloud infrastructure required to host and deliver frontend applications. This is an ongoing, long-term opportunity.
You will work primarily with React and AWS, implementing CI/CD and deployment pipelines for frontend applications and using core AWS services to support frontend hosting and delivery. The role is frontend-leaning, with a proposed split of roughly 70% frontend and 30% backend.
Responsibilities
- Build and maintain dashboards and admin consoles using React.
- Implement CI/CD and deployment pipelines for frontend applications on AWS.
- Work with core AWS services to support frontend hosting and delivery.
Requirements
- 5+ years of experience with AWS.
- 3+ years of experience building dashboards and/or admin consoles.
- 2+ years of experience with CI/CD and deployment for frontend applications on AWS, or general CI/CD experience using GitHub Actions or GitLab CI with willingness to pick up AWS-specific deployment.
- 3+ years of experience with React, or equivalent experience with Vue or Angular.
